Taxonomic Classification

Rank Camiguin Bullimus Felt Saddle
Kingdom Animalia (Animals) Fungi (Fungi)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Ascomycota (Sac Fungi)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Pezizomycetes (Pezizomycetes)
Order Rodentia (Rodents) Pezizales (Pezizales)
Family Muridae (Mice & Rats) Helvellaceae
Genus Bullimus Helvella
Species Bullimus gamay Helvella macropus
